Amid all the great contenders for Best Southside Restaurant, Mi Nidito continues to reign at the top. And for good reason: For nearly seven decades, this little nest has been serving up the finest in Sonoran-style Mexican food. If it's good enough for Bill Clinton, Julio Iglesias and Lute Olson, it's good enough for us—even if it mean waiting in line for a little while.
